Output 3d171ed1f13b5ef4444f4de3f70726c36768b4eb3f41d936a5420155d81e3eee:43

value
18231580
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49a2c9ac01e2d5a906a5dbd58a1f531ca72ef6ea8ed4fbc38b95af883ae62dec
address
tb1pfx3vntqput26jp49m02c586nrjnjaah23m20hsutjkhcswhx9hkqqwx8d2
transaction
3d171ed1f13b5ef4444f4de3f70726c36768b4eb3f41d936a5420155d81e3eee
confirmations
33659
spent
true